Bollywood Stars Emraan Hashmi And Mallika Sherawat Reunite At Glamorous Mumbai Event
At the lavish reception of Anand Pandit's daughter, Aishwarya, a constellation of Bollywood stars illuminated the evening, but it was the reunion of Emraan Hashmi and Mallika Sherawat that captured everyone's attention. The duo, known for their sizzling chemistry in the 2004 hit 'Murder', posed together once again, reigniting memories of their previous collaboration two decades ago. Mallika Sherawat appeared radiant in a pink dress, while Emraan Hashmi complemented her in a sleek black suit. Their warm embrace hinted at a fond reunion, making it a momentous highlight of the night.
Taapsee Pannu also graced the event, marking her first public appearance since her recent nuptials to Mathias Boe. Dressed in a stunning red saree adorned with a golden zari border and paired with a sleeveless blouse, she exuded elegance. The paparazzi were quick to congratulate her on her marriage, to which she responded with a gracious smile, though her husband was notably absent from the event.

Adding to the glamour was Shah Rukh Khan, who, fresh from entertaining fans on Eid, arrived in style wearing a black suit and sporting a man bun. His greeting, a respectful 'salaam' to the photographers, showcased his undiminished charm and charisma that has long captivated audiences worldwide.
The reception saw an impressive turnout of Bollywood celebrities, including Abhishek Bachchan, Shilpa Shetty with Raj Kundra, Arpita and Aayush Khan, as well as Ayushmann Khurrana, Bhumi Pednekar, Rajkummar Rao, and Patralekha.
